Professional Buying Guide: Ionic vs Conventional Hair Dryers
Understanding the fundamental differences between ionic and conventional dryers is crucial for preventing damage. Ionic technology works by emitting negative ions that break down water molecules faster, reducing drying time and heat exposure.
| Feature | Ionic Hair Dryer | Conventional Hair Dryer |
|---|---|---|
| Drying Time | 30-40% faster | Standard |
| Heat Damage Risk | Lower with proper use | Higher |
| Static Reduction | Excellent | Minimal |
| Price Point | $80-$300+ | $20-$100 |

Technical Specifications: How Ionic Technology Works
Quality ionic hair dryers generate approximately 2-6 million negative ions per cubic centimeter. The ions neutralize positive charges in hair, sealing cuticles and reducing frizz. Professional models maintain consistent ion output while consumer-grade units may fluctuate after prolonged use.
Manufacturing standards require ionic generators to withstand temperatures up to 140°F without degradation. Reputable brands like Dyson and Panasonic use military-grade components that ensure consistent performance for 5-7 years with proper maintenance.
Global Market Trends and Regional Preferences
According to Statista, European markets show 42% higher demand for dual-voltage ionic dryers compared to North America. Southeast Asian markets prioritize compact designs with 220V compatibility. The 2024 EU regulations will mandate energy efficiency class B or higher for all hair care appliances.
Environmental compliance now requires mercury-free components and 85% recyclable materials. California Prop 65 compliance is essential for US imports, while REACH certification dominates European markets.
Frequently Asked Questions
Can ionic hair dryers damage curly hair?
When used correctly with heat protectant, ionic technology enhances curl definition. However, high heat settings without proper technique can cause dryness.
What certifications should professional buyers require?
UL 859 for safety, CE marking for Europe, and RoHS compliance for hazardous substances. ISO 9001 manufacturing certification indicates quality consistency.
Are there customs restrictions for ionic hair dryers?
Most countries classify hair dryers under HS code 8516.31. Documentation should include safety certificates and voltage compatibility statements.
